Title :
Tunable Y-type waveguide power divider as standard mismatch

Abstract :
A method is proposed for generating standards of voltage standing wave ratio (v.s.w.r.) of values ¿ 2 by a waveguide device consisting of a Y-type junction matched to the input guide (power divider), with a tunable ratio of power division, an adjustable sliding short circuit and a matched load. A detailed analysis of errors is given, which considers the effects of a possible deviation of the symmetry of the junction and of the uncertainties in the determination of the reflection coefficient and of the position of the short circuit.
